Window Cost by Type

Replacing your windows is a major investment, so balancing cost with durability is vital. Although top-of-the-line windows may be more expensive to buy, they often yield better long-term value due to their extended lifespan. The material, size, and style of your new windows play the largest role in determining your final cost. Simple double-hung windows deliver great value with their straightforward style and simple mechanisms, while new skylights cost more to prepare for and install. An installer can guide you through selecting the solutions that fit your requirements.

This table shows average prices for various window types to give you an idea of what to expect.

Window TypesAverage Cost
Arched$215-$1322
Awning$311-$868
Bay$718-$5330
Custom$319-$888
Casement$248-$1441
Double-hung$116-$750
Egress$213-$532
Glass Block$42-$539
Picture$187-$1381
Single-hung$84-$1421
Skylight$106-$1283
Sliding$244-$1243
Storm$50-$351
Transom$260-$544

Window Material Cost

You'll also need to pick a window material. Homeowners usually base their decision on aesthetic preferences, energy efficiency objectives and the local climate. Aluminum windows are perfect for sleek, modern designs, but they cost more up-front. You'll pay less for wood windows up-front, but you'll need to invest in regular maintenance to prevent the frame from warping and wear. Vinyl is readily available and tends to cost less, but don't underestimate its strong durability and low maintenance needs.

Window TypesAverage Cost
Aluminum$50-$1421
Composite$513-$1152
Fiberglass$84-$718
Vinyl$172-$1599
Wood$256-$1441

Licensing and Credentials

Window companies in Florida need a general, glazing, or residential license from the state Construction Industry Licensing Board. Some licenses let companies operate in one location only, while others enable crews to work statewide. Cities might have their own additional licenses, but they cannot overlap with licenses that the state oversees.

Frequently Asked Questions About Window Replacement in Cape Coral

How could new windows help my energy efficiency?

In Cape Coral specifically, most homeowners using efficient windows lower their carbon emissions by 390 pounds per year. That amounts to $400 of annual savings.

The U.S. Department of Energy states that 25%–30% of a home's heating and cooling capacity is used to compensate for heat gain and heat loss through windows. By investing in new, more efficient windows, you can enhance your home's energy efficiency and lower your electricity bills.

How frequently should I upgrade or replace my windows?

Windows don't have an indefinite lifespan, and most vinyl models are constructed to serve your home for 15–20 years. Over time, weatherproofing materials weaken, framing contracts and expands, and window coatings fade. These changes result in condensation, energy loss, air leaks, and other expensive problems necessitating repair or replacement.

How can I fix a broken window screen?

It depends on the tear size and where it's located on your window. You can usually fix small tears yourself using a special kit. Some window providers will supply you with one when they install your windows, or you can buy one for $5–10 from a hardware store. Bigger tears, or those located at the edge of a window, usually need professional assistance.
